A photographer's contract with a client defines the relationship and expectations of both parties involved. It usually covers scope of work, payment details, copyright ownership, and deadlines. This contract serves to protect the interests of both the photographer and the client. Considering a New Mexico Agreement between Photographer and Purchaser of Photographs can enhance the legal standing of your contract.

Writing a photography contract requires clarity and attention to detail. Start by including the names of the photographer and client, along with specific services offered. It’s crucial to outline the payment terms, delivery timelines, and usage rights.
